No one can know the future, so even if you are doing fine, you still need health insurance. A bad day in the Big Apple with insurance is always better than a bad day without it.

Why is that? When medical needs are not planned, even the most basic care costs a lot here. And when you don’t have health coverage, those “everyday” events can really add up fast:

– Need to go to the emergency room? One ER visit costs $1,6681

– Tear your ACL while going for a jog in Central Park? In the U.S., knee surgery runs $13,403.382

– Fall off a CitiBike and break your wrist? You could pay from $6,577 – $8,181 here in NYC3

Sadly, most New Yorkers are not prepared for the cost of these misfortunes, or others. In both NYC and other places, many people earn at or below the federal poverty level.
